Microsoft Azure SQL Database offers scalability, reliability, and easy integration with Microsoft services. It features cost-efficiency, security, and high availability, supporting global access with automatic tuning and user-friendly interfaces. Organizations benefit from reduced infrastructure maintenance.
Azure SQL Database supports content management, data warehousing, OLTP, and analytics while providing backend functions for applications and managing financial transactions. It integrates seamlessly with SAP, supports variable workloads with scalability, and enables smooth cloud migration. Well-suited for hosting Power Platform apps, it enhances performance with predefined templates, facilitates ERP and HR solutions, and aids in reporting, maintaining customer databases, and supporting enterprise applications across industries. However, users seek improvements in pricing, documentation, support, third-party integration, advanced automation, intuitive interfaces, especially in expanding regions. Challenges include configuration, scalability, and security with complex queries or on-premises features, alongside data export and AI integration tool needs.

Upstash is commonly used for serverless data caching and job queue management, leveraging a Redis-compatible API for real-time data processing and seamless integration with cloud functions. It is also noted for cost-effective, scalable data storage with minimal maintenance.
Upstash offers efficient serverless Redis, low latency, and cost-effective pricing, making integration with existing workflows straightforward and scalable. With multi-region support and data persistence, Upstash provides reliable performance and a simple setup process. Users do indicate some areas for improvement, such as slow query performance and occasional data inconsistencies, as well as the need for more robust documentation and improved customer support. Additionally, scaling during peak loads can present challenges, and advanced feature requests are often anticipated.
